一种神经网络模型的对抗鲁棒性评估方法.docxVIP

  • 2
  • 0
  • 约4.37千字
  • 约 8页
  • 2026-01-31 发布于河南
  • 举报

一种神经网络模型的对抗鲁棒性评估方法.docx

一种神经网络模型的对抗鲁棒性评估方法

姓名:__________考号:__________

题号

总分

评分

一、单选题(共10题)

1.以下哪项不是评估神经网络对抗鲁棒性的常用方法?()

A.生成对抗样本测试

B.鲁棒性测试

C.准确性测试

D.训练时间测试

2.在对抗样本生成中,以下哪种攻击方法不是基于梯度的方法?()

A.FastGradientSignMethod(FGSM)

B.CarliniWagnerAttack

C.DeepFool

D.ProjectedGradientDescent(PGD)

3.以下哪种方法在对抗样本生成中不会导致模型预测错误?()

A.L2扰动

B.L1扰动

C.差分扰动

D.恒等变换

4.在评估神经网络的对抗鲁棒性时,以下哪种度量标准不常用?()

A.漏洞率

B.损失值

C.负面样本率

D.鲁棒性得分

5.在对抗样本生成过程中,以下哪种策略可以增加对抗样本的多样性?()

A.使用不同的攻击方法

B.对样本进行随机化

C.对模型参数进行优化

D.仅使用高置信度样本

6.以下哪种方法可以帮助提高神经网络的对抗鲁棒性?()

A.数据增强

B.模型正则化

C.使用更深的网络

D.降低学习率

7.在对抗样本生成过程中,以下哪种方法可以有效地减少计算复杂度?()

A.使用预训练模型

B.使用更简单的攻击方法

C.对样本进行降维

D.使用更高效的优化算法

8.在对抗样本生成中,以下哪种扰动方法可以产生最轻微的样本扰动?()

A.L2扰动

B.L1扰动

C.差分扰动

D.恒等变换

9.以下哪种方法不适用于评估神经网络的对抗鲁棒性?()

A.人工分析

B.自动化测试

C.黑盒测试

D.白盒测试

10.在对抗样本生成中,以下哪种方法可以有效地处理高维数据?()

A.使用更简单的攻击方法

B.对样本进行降维

C.使用更复杂的优化算法

D.增加模型参数

二、多选题(共5题)

11.以下哪些方法是评估神经网络对抗鲁棒性的常用技术?()

A.生成对抗样本测试

B.鲁棒性测试

C.准确性测试

D.模型训练时间测试

E.特征提取分析

12.在对抗样本生成中,以下哪些策略可以用来提高对抗样本的多样性?()

A.使用不同的攻击方法

B.对样本进行随机化

C.对模型参数进行优化

D.仅使用高置信度样本

E.引入噪声

13.以下哪些方法可以用来提高神经网络的对抗鲁棒性?()

A.数据增强

B.模型正则化

C.使用更深的网络

D.增加模型参数

E.使用预训练模型

14.以下哪些是评估神经网络对抗鲁棒性的度量标准?()

A.漏洞率

B.损失值

C.负面样本率

D.鲁棒性得分

E.准确性

15.以下哪些方法在对抗样本生成中可以减少计算复杂度?()

A.使用预训练模型

B.使用简单的攻击方法

C.对样本进行降维

D.使用更高效的优化算法

E.增加模型参数

三、填空题(共5题)

16.在对抗鲁棒性评估中,用于衡量模型对对抗样本的预测准确性的指标通常是______。

17.对抗样本生成方法中,______方法通过计算对抗样本与原始样本之间的距离来调整扰动。

18.在评估神经网络的对抗鲁棒性时,通常需要使用______来生成对抗样本。

19.为了提高神经网络的对抗鲁棒性,可以采用______等策略。

20.在对抗样本生成过程中,为了减少计算复杂度,可以采用______等方法。

四、判断题(共5题)

21.使用预训练模型可以提高神经网络的对抗鲁棒性。()

A.正确B.错误

22.生成对抗样本时,扰动越大,攻击效果越好。()

A.正确B.错误

23.在对抗样本生成中,L2扰动比L1扰动更容易生成对抗样本。()

A.正确B.错误

24.提高神经网络模型的复杂度一定可以提高其对抗鲁棒性。()

A.正确B.错误

25.数据增强是一种减少对抗样本生成过程中计算复杂度的方法。()

A.正确B.错误

五、简单题(共5题)

26.什么是对抗样本?

27.什么是FastGradientSignMethod(FGSM)?

28.如何评估神经网络的对抗鲁棒性?

29.数据增强在提高神经网络

文档评论(0)

1亿VIP精品文档

相关文档